Transaction 859fd5f3263b87b52c2ad0465465fdd931d5dcbce8f025ddeb8b76ab7d424563
1 Input
1 Output
-
859fd5f3263b87b52c2ad0465465fdd931d5dcbce8f025ddeb8b76ab7d424563:0
- value
- 840892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d00fbe28469f99ef1fbb7b2100fb313fc3033123 OP_EQUAL
- address
- 3Lf9LGpTTHAjmhsKJuhWsAJRqqSmFHUXej